WebThe coconut tree has a fibrous root system that grows just below the surface of the soil in a mass from the base of the tree. Only a few of the roots penetrate the soil for stability. The coconut palm has an erect or slightly curved stem that grows from a swollen base. The stem is smooth, light gray, and has prominent leaf scars. Uses of the Coconut Tree in different ways - The Kalpavrishkha WebAug 7, 2024 · The coconut tree grows from a single seed, which is an entire coconut, taking between 3 and 8 years to bear fruit, and living between 60 and 100 years. Each coconut takes almost a year to develop from a flower into a fruit. Can coconut trees survive winter?

WebAs the coconut tree is propagated by seed, they are subjected to some variations which can be distinguished in the trees, fruits and leaves. As such, there are hundreds of vernacular names for the coconut types (Figure 4.1). Tall coconut palms. Tall coconut palms are usually cross-pollinated, and are subjected to the most variations.
